Marissa just completed her first semester in college. She earned an A in her four-hour statistics course, a B in her three-hour sociology course, an A in her three hour psychology course, a C in her five-hour computer programming course, and an A in her one-hour drama course. Determine Marissa’s grade-point average.

Approach Assign point values to each grade. Let an A equal 4 points, a B equal 3 points, and a C equal 2 points. The number of credit hours for each course determines its weight. So a five-hour course gets a weight of 5, a four-hour course gets a weight of 4, and so on. Multiply the weight of each course by the points earned in the course, add these products, and divide this sum by the sum of the weights, number of credit hours.
